" -----Original Message----- From: Krishnakumar B [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ED] Sent: Monday, July 10, 2006 3:55 PM To: [email protected] Subject: Geronimo clustering Hi, I am trying out geronimo clustering example. I seem to have a problem with Session Failover. I am using Apache HTTP server 2.0.58 and mod_jk 1.2.15 and geronimo 1.1 I create two session variables in server 1 - server1-1 = 1 & server1-2 = 2 I stop server1. Only server1-2 = 2 replicated in server 2. Now i add a new variable in server2 server2-1 = 1 Now i start server1 Now i stop server2 I should have server1-1=1, server1-2=2 and server2-1=1 in server1 Instead i have only server2-1=1 in server1 I am not sure if i am doing something wrong. I have set jvmRoute in config.xml, given correct IP address in cluster application plan and setup workers.properties. I get these messages in server2 15:38:37,452 WARN [JvmRouteBinderValve] No engine jvmRoute attribute configured! and 15:30:57,791 INFO [DeltaManager] Manager [/servlets-examples-cluster]: skipping state transfer. No members active in cluster group. though both members of cluster are up and i am able to ping both machines. there are in same subnet. Thanks for any pointers...
